Fuji lens roadmap (2013/2014) update - WyldRage - 01-06-2014

Just announced:

56 f1.2 (999$)

 

Upcoming in 2014:

High speed Wide Angle Lens (probably 16mm, since it sits between the 18mm and 14mm)

16-55 f2.8

50-140 f2.8

18-135 f3.5-5.6

 

Upcoming in 2015:

Super Telephoto Zoom lens

 

My impressions:

- The 56mm is not as costly as I feared, nor as affordable as I hoped. The press release doesn't mention optical distortion correction unfortunately, but neither did the 35mm or the 14mm, so it can go either way.

- Fuji still hasn't broken the $1k barrier, though that will probably change with the upcoming high-end zoom lenses.

- Still missing a telephoto prime: something in the 135-150mm equivalent range. It's a classic 35mm film lens focal length, both Leica and for SLR, and one of the best mirrorless lens is found in that range: the Olympus 75mm f1.8.

- I guess the 18-135mm will be weather-sealed and sold as the kit lens for the *rumored* upcoming weather-sealed camera. The timing works and having a Zoom with a large range weather-sealed just makes sense.

- The f2.8 pro zooms will have to be weather-sealed as well: it's the only way to make the upgrade from the 18-55mm f2.8-4, an extremely well reviewed lens, seem worth it.
